Mastering the Art of Database Optimization in the AI-Driven Era
Database Optimization

Mastering the Art of Database Optimization in the AI-Driven Era

Unleash the full potential of your databases through cutting-edge optimization techniques designed for the AI-driven era.

Published October 20, 2025 Tags: Database Optimization, AI, Machine Learning, Real-Time Analytics, Cloud-based Databases, Serverless Architecture, Distributed Databases

Introduction

As the digital landscape continues to evolve rapidly, businesses are handling more data than ever before. This surge in data necessitates robust and efficient database systems to ensure the smooth running of applications and services. Today, we will dive deep into modern strategies to optimize databases in the era of AI and machine learning.

Embrace AI and Machine Learning for Database Optimization

Artificial Intelligence (AI) and Machine Learning (ML) have revolutionized how we manage and optimize databases. These technologies provide automated and intelligent solutions for database tuning, query optimization, and workload management. For example, using predictive analytics, they can anticipate future loads and adjust resources accordingly to ensure high performance and availability.

Code Example: Using AI for Database Tuning


// Import AI-powered optimization library
import aiOptimize from 'ai-optimize';

// Initialize your database
const db = new Database('your-database');

// Apply AI optimization
aiOptimize.tune(db);

Adopt Real-Time Analytics

Real-time analytics play a crucial role in modern database optimization. By analyzing the data as it enters the system, businesses can make instantaneous decisions, providing a competitive edge. In-memory databases and stream processing technologies are critical in achieving real-time analytics.

Code Example: Real-Time Stream Processing


// Import stream processing library
import Stream from 'stream-process';

// Initialize your stream
const stream = new Stream('your-stream');

// Implement real-time analytics
stream.analyze(data => {
  // Perform your real-time analysis here
});

Transition to Cloud-Based Databases and Serverless Architectures

Cloud-based databases and serverless architectures are transforming the way businesses handle data. These technologies offer scalability, elasticity, and cost-effectiveness, making them perfect for modern database optimization. You can dynamically allocate and de-allocate resources based on demand, ensuring optimal performance at all times.

Embrace Distributed Databases

Distributed databases offer a solution to the growing need for speed, scalability, and resilience in data management. By storing data across multiple nodes, distributed databases ensure high availability and fault tolerance. They also provide the advantage of geographical distribution, bringing your data closer to your users.

Conclusion

To stay competitive in the AI-driven era, businesses must optimize their databases using the latest technologies and trends. By embracing AI and machine learning, adopting real-time analytics, transitioning to the cloud, and implementing distributed databases, you can ensure the speed, scalability, and reliability of your data management systems. Remember that database optimization is an ongoing process, requiring continuous monitoring and adjustments based on your evolving business needs and technology advancements.

Tags

Database Optimization AI Machine Learning Real-Time Analytics Cloud-based Databases Serverless Architecture Distributed Databases
← Back to Blog
Category: Database Optimization

Related Posts

Coming Soon

More articles on Database Optimization coming soon.